Abstract(in English) It is difficult to find that the neural network use where part of patterns for the recognition. Cause of that is nonlinearity of networks. This paper describes a recognition mechanism of a four layer backpropagation neural network using Alopex algorithm. We have developed a small scale four-layered neural network model for simple character recognition, which can recognize the patterns transformed by affine conversion. Alopex algorithm is an iterative and stochastic processing to minimize or maximize a cost function. By these methods the receptive fields of the units in the output layers are obtained.
